how to remove dash 240d 123

I have been searching for a thread on how to remove the dash in a 123. I have not found what I was looking for. I am sure I saw one the other day, but can't find it now.

The box that controls the airflow on my 1980 240D apears to be jammed. There is a lever in the console that coltrols a cable that goes to the box, but it only moves half way. My guess is that there is a pencil, nail file or some other debris that has fallen down the defroster vent and jammed the mechanism.

The A/C probably has not worked for years. I am replacing the A/C compressor, expansion valve, and drier. I will also remove the condenser and flush it seperatly and also flush the entire system. The mercedes book says to remove the expansion valve, gut it, then put it back in. Without the valve in the block, you can then flush the system effectivley. The remaining problem is to clean the evaporator and heater core. Then of course you install the new expansion valve block.

Since it looks like I have to rempove the dash to clear the debris out of the diverter box, it should be a no brainer to remove the evaporator and heater cores to clean them.

After cleaning cores, flushing system and replacing components I will recharge with R12. Turns out getting a cert to handle R12 is a cinch. A 30 lb. bottle on eBay sells for about $450.

Anything else I should look for while I have the dash off? If I can get it off!
